Eggertsville is a hamlet in the town of Amherst, located in Erie County, New York. Here are some potential advantages or "pros" of traveling to Eggertsville:
-
Proximity to Buffalo: Eggertsville is located just outside the city of Buffalo. This makes it a convenient location for those looking to explore the cultural, dining, and entertainment options in Buffalo while staying in a quieter suburban area.
-
University at Buffalo: Eggertsville is near the University at Buffalo, which offers cultural events, lectures, and sporting events. It can be a good place to visit if you are attending events or visiting students at the university.
-
Suburban Atmosphere: For travelers looking to experience a more relaxed, suburban environment, Eggertsville offers a contrast to the more urban setting of nearby Buffalo.
-
Access to Nature: The area around Eggertsville, particularly in the larger town of Amherst, has several parks and green spaces that are ideal for outdoor activities like hiking, biking, and picnicking.
-
Local Dining and Shopping: While Eggertsville itself might not be a large commercial hub, its proximity to Buffalo and other parts of Amherst means there are plenty of dining and shopping options nearby.
-
Community Feel: Visiting Eggertsville can offer a sense of local community and neighborhood life, which can be appealing for travelers interested in experiencing local culture more intimately.
-
Niagara Falls: Eggertsville is not far from Niagara Falls, making it a suitable base for day trips to this world-famous natural attraction.
-
Cultural and Historical Sites: In and around the Buffalo area, there are various cultural and historical sites to explore, such as the Frank Lloyd Wright-designed Darwin D. Martin House and the Albright-Knox Art Gallery.
Overall, Eggertsville can be a convenient and pleasant location for those looking to explore the greater Buffalo area while enjoying a quieter, suburban setting.

Eggertsville is a suburban community located in the town of Amherst, near Buffalo, New York. While it offers some benefits due to its proximity to Buffalo and the University at Buffalo, there can be some potential drawbacks to consider when traveling there:
-
Limited Tourist Attractions: Eggertsville itself is primarily a residential area and does not have major tourist attractions. Travelers might need to venture into Buffalo or other nearby areas for more sightseeing and entertainment options.
-
Weather Conditions: Like much of Western New York, Eggertsville experiences cold and snowy winters, which might be a downside for visitors not accustomed to or prepared for such weather conditions.
-
Traffic and Congestion: Being part of the greater Buffalo area, Eggertsville can experience traffic congestion, particularly during peak hours, which might be inconvenient for travelers.
-
Public Transportation: While there are public transportation options available, they might not be as extensive or convenient as in larger cities, potentially making it necessary to have a car to get around more easily.
-
Lack of Nightlife: As a suburban area, Eggertsville doesn't have a vibrant nightlife scene. Travelers looking for nightlife activities might need to head into downtown Buffalo.
-
Limited Accommodation Options: Being a residential suburb, Eggertsville may have fewer hotel and lodging options compared to larger cities, which could be inconvenient for travelers looking for convenient or varied accommodation.
Overall, while Eggertsville offers a peaceful suburban environment, travelers looking for a bustling city atmosphere or a wide range of tourist activities might find it somewhat limited.
